Problems with HPSMH timeouts and VCAgent

Hello,

 

i have a proliant dl380 g7 server with newest firmware + drivers. when i start smh, i get after some time a timeout failure.

then i take a look in task-manager and see that the vcagent process is sized tp 10gb memory.

 

when i kill this process, or i deactivate this service, the smh works fine.

 

its this a known bug and what can i do to solve this?

Dave73
Regular Advisor

Re: Problems with HPSMH timeouts and VCAgent

You could increase the timeout settings for SMH and see if it helps,

 

 

 \hp\hpsmh\bin\
smhconfig -B 90

 

Check it with

 

smhconfig -V
